Pre-ride Safety Checklist for a 2025 Suzuki DRZ50

Before hitting the trails with your 2025 Suzuki DRZ50, it's crucial to perform a thorough pre-ride safety check. This ensures not only your safety but also the longevity of your dirt bike. The DRZ50 is a reliable model, but like any machine, it requires regular maintenance and checks to perform at its best.

1. Tire Pressure & Condition

Check the tire pressure to ensure it matches the manufacturer's recommended levels. Inspect the tires for any signs of wear or damage, such as cracks or punctures. Proper tire maintenance is essential for optimal handling and safety.

2. Brakes

Test the front and rear brakes to ensure they are functioning correctly. Listen for any unusual noises and check the brake pads for wear. Replace any components that show signs of excessive wear to maintain stopping power.

3. Chain & Sprockets

Inspect the chain for proper tension and lubrication. A loose or dry chain can lead to poor performance and potential damage. Check the sprockets for wear and replace them if necessary to ensure smooth power delivery.

4. Fluid Levels

Check the oil level and quality, as well as the coolant level. Maintaining proper fluid levels is crucial for engine performance and longevity. Replace or top up fluids as needed.

5. Controls & Cables

Ensure that all controls, including the throttle, clutch, and brake levers, operate smoothly. Inspect cables for any signs of fraying or damage and replace them if necessary to prevent failure during a ride.

6. Lights & Electrical

Test all lights and electrical components to ensure they are functioning correctly. This includes the headlight, taillight, and any indicators. A well-functioning electrical system is vital for visibility and safety.

7. Frame & Suspension

Inspect the frame for any signs of cracks or damage. Check the suspension components for leaks or wear. Proper suspension setup is key to handling and comfort on the trails.

8. Fuel System

Ensure the fuel tank is filled with fresh gasoline and check for any leaks in the fuel system. A clean and efficient fuel system is essential for reliable engine performance.

By following this pre-ride safety checklist, you can ensure that your 2025 Suzuki DRZ50 is ready for a safe and enjoyable ride. Regular maintenance and checks are vital to keep your dirt bike in top condition and to prevent any unexpected issues on the trail.
